Repairing Hitachi Refrigerators
When your trusty Hitachi refrigerator starts acting up, it can be a major inconvenience. Luckily, many common issues are easily solved with a little DIY know-how. Before you call in a technician, try these troubleshooting steps to get your fridge back on track. First, inspect the power cord and outlet to make sure there's a good connection. If that doesn't work, investigate for tripped breakers or blown fuses in your electrical panel. Next, consult your refrigerator's manual for specific troubleshooting guides tailored to your model. Inside the fridge, verify the temperature settings are correct website and that the door seals are tightly closed.
- Moreover, pay attention any unusual noises or movements. These could indicate a problem with the compressor, condenser coils, or other internal components.
- Should you're comfortable working with electrical appliances, you can investigate further. However, for complex repairs, it's always best to contact a qualified appliance repair professional.
Please note that regular maintenance can help prevent future issues and keep your Hitachi refrigerator running smoothly for years to come.
